Market Notes

Compared to last week steers under 600 lbs sold steady, 600 to 650 lbs sold 9.00 higher, 650 to 700 lbs sold steady and over 800 lbs sold 6.00 higher. Most of the heifers sold 2.00 to 6.00 higher with 700 lbs steady on the day. Demand was good with several load lots on hand. Nice spring like weather with lots of sunshine and warm temperatures.

Supply included: 95% Feeder Cattle (69% Steers, 31% Heifers); 5% Slaughter Cattle (100% Cows). Feeder cattle supply over 600 lbs was 75%. *Approx is the middle weight of the weight group multiplied by the mid point of the high and low for the group. It's meant as a quick method to see what cattle of that weight class are bringing per head.
